Core claim
Frame-alignment mechanisms operate in AI-agent communities but through concentrated production: 26 of 227 authors make strong claims, the top two account for 44 percent and the top five for 62 percent, and the legal-governance effect is driven primarily by a single author who supplies 46 percent of those claims. The only pre-registered subtype contrast that survives is security threat leading to threat claims; the predicted status-recognition to status link fails in the opposite direction.

read the original abstract
Frame-alignment and collective-identity theories explain how external events become public claims about a group's standing, vulnerability, rights, or obligations. Whether such mechanisms travel to AI-agent communities is unsettled. We test this on Moltbook, an open agent-only platform, coding 1{,}706 post-level units against a four-dimension rubric with Qwen3.5-397B as the primary coder and Claude Sonnet as an independent secondary coder ($\kappa=0.72$ on identification, $0.70$ on commonality, $0.37$ on the layered strong-claim derivation). Three findings emerge. First, event coverage drives attention: event-typed posts attract 27--60\% more comments at $p<0.0001$, but strong-claim status itself adds nothing. Second, identity-claim formation is real but concentrated: 26 of 227 authors (11\%) make any strong claim; top two = 44\%, top five = 62\%; the H1 legal-governance effect (Fisher OR$=4.35$, $p=0.0001$) is driven primarily by a single author who produces 46\% of legal-governance strong claims, with the Firth-penalized estimate attenuating to $\beta=0.68$, $p=0.11$. Third, the only pre-registered subtype contrast that survives at $\alpha=0.05$ is \textit{security threat $\to$ threat} ($p=0.005$); the predicted \textit{status recognition $\to$ status} contrast fails in the wrong direction. We read the findings through the frame-entrepreneur tradition: a small set of authors produces most identity-claim text, and what looks like a corpus-wide event-to-identity mechanism is largely their textual output. The unexpected status-recognition $\to$ threat pattern is textually consistent with distinctiveness-threat predictions, but the small subset producing it and residual LLM-coder bias warrant caution.

Referee Report
Summary. The paper tests whether frame-alignment and collective-identity mechanisms from social movement theory operate in the Moltbook AI-agent community. Coding 1,706 posts via a four-dimension LLM rubric (Qwen3.5-397B primary, Claude Sonnet secondary), it reports that event-typed posts attract more comments, identity-claim production is highly concentrated (26/227 authors produce any strong claims; top-5 account for 62%), the legal-governance effect is largely driven by one author, and only the security-threat to threat contrast survives pre-registration. The authors interpret the patterns as evidence that a small set of frame entrepreneurs accounts for most identity-claim text.
Significance. If the strong-claim labels prove reliable, the work usefully extends frame-alignment theory to AI-agent platforms and quantifies concentration of claim production. Positive features include pre-registered contrasts, inter-coder kappa reporting, and use of Fisher exact tests plus Firth-penalized regression. The concentration result, if robust, would parallel findings on human social movements and highlight risks of over-attributing corpus-wide mechanisms to a few prolific authors.
major comments (2)
- [Methods, LLM coding rubric] Methods, LLM coding rubric: The κ=0.37 on the layered strong-claim derivation (vs. 0.70–0.72 on identification/commonality) is low. All headline concentration statistics (26/227 authors, top-5=62%, one author 46% of legal-governance claims) and the Fisher OR=4.35 are computed directly from this binary label. Modest systematic bias in the LLM rubric could artifactually generate the observed skew; a sensitivity analysis or human validation of the strong-claim subset is required.
- [Results, H1 legal-governance effect] Results, H1 legal-governance effect: The reported OR=4.35 (p=0.0001) attenuates to β=0.68, p=0.11 after Firth penalty and is driven by a single author. This detail indicates the event-to-identity link is largely author-specific rather than a general mechanism, which undercuts the corpus-wide interpretation and should be treated as a central limitation rather than supporting evidence for frame entrepreneurs.
